编码

素材UI文件上传介绍|素材UI文件上传 & 例子

材质UI是最优化和有效的工具,添加图形和动画的十博体育投注官网和使用技术...

写的 丹尼尔Roncaglia · 3分钟阅读 >
材质UI文件上传

材料UI是将图形和动画添加到十博体育投注官网中并通过技术和科学创新来使用它的最优化和最有效的工具. 它本质上是谷歌在2014年创建的一种设计语言. 有时候,你会发现很难弄清楚怎么做 材质UI文件上传 作品.

它集成了所有的JavaScript web框架, 包括AngularJS, VueJS, 和ReactJS, 制作出更精彩更有反应的节目. Material UI是一个流行的React用户界面框架,在GitHub上有超过35,000颗星.

材质UI的功能包括低级实用功能——被称为“样式功能”——可以用来创建复杂的设计系统.

为什么材料界面?

Material UI是十博体育投注最喜欢的React UI库, 老实说, 十博体育投注想不出第二个建议. 

然而,由于各种原因,创建一个漂亮的UI库是一项挑战. It’s not just the time and effort it takes to create functional and attractive components that creates a roadblock; rather, 该库还需要有良好的文档记录, 有实际模型, 并处理无穷无尽的边缘情况,如反应性, 可用性, 本地化, 主题, 等等.

材料UI是十博体育投注公司项目的默认选择,因为它已经投入了大量的工作. 如果您曾经尝试过创建UI库, 你知道要获得合适的样式和功能是多么耗时. 

作为一个结果, 使用材质UI将节省大量的时间,你可以投入到开发特定项目的功能.

主题值直接从组件属性访问. 还有其他好处. 例如材质UI:

  • 鼓励用户界面的一致性
  • 写响应轻松
  • 使用任何主题对象
  • 是否足够快来执行所有的功能.

Filestack,上传文件很容易,没有麻烦. 

材质UI组件的例子有哪些?

当学习如何实现材质UI时,你将花费大部分时间在“组件”区域. 每个组件最重要的方面是,您通常可以在页面上试验实际的模型.

Try clicking on the code symbol for each example to see the entire source code: > for each example. 您会注意到每个组件上最常见的东西是如何使用它的示例, 但你可能想要检查它是如何使用的, 实现的CSS, 以及完整的导入列表.

因此,您应该总是单击“显示完整的源”图标. 你甚至可以使用“编辑代码和框”选项来实时查看示例.

最好的部分是这些示例发挥了作用, 因此,您可以将整个代码复制到您的项目中,然后毫不费力地集成示例. 这些示例通常是创造性的,并利用了各种材质UI功能.

如何使用材质界面上传文件?

TextField可以用来上传简单的文件.

这是代码看起来的样子:

  name = " upload-photo "

  type = "文件"

/>

类型道具必须设置为文件.

你怎么让它成为你自己的?

十博体育投注可能需要改变基本的控制,因为它们并不是很有趣. 然而,这个过程很简单,因为十博体育投注正在使用材质UI.

步骤1:创建一个Input

使用属性id和file创建一个html输入. We don’t want to see it; therefore, use style=’display:none’.

这就是代码显示的方式.

         id = " upload-photo "  

         name = " upload-photo "  

         type = "文件"/> 

步骤2:自定义代码

十博体育投注在第一步中建立的输入创建一个标签.

根据你想要你的文件上传的外观,使用材质UI按钮或Fab.

让十博体育投注从一个按钮开始.

向十博体育投注刚刚创建的标签添加一个按钮组件. 设置道具组件的值范围. 否则, the button element will render using the HTML button> tag, 什么会导致十博体育投注的文件上传失败.

按钮元素的代码如下所示. 

  

    样式={{display: ' none '}}

    id = " upload-photo "

    name = " upload-photo "

    type = "文件"

  />

  

    上传按钮

  

;

现在让十博体育投注看看一个新的用户界面.

为此,十博体育投注将使用Material UI Fab元素. 代码与按钮示例的代码非常相似.

  

    样式={{display: ' none '}}

    id = " upload-photo "

    name = " upload-photo "

    type = "文件"

  />

  

    颜色=“二级”

    大小= "小"

    组件=“跨越”

    aria-label = "添加"

    变量= "扩展"

  >

     Upload photo

  

  

  

  

    

  

;

你准备好做材质UI文件上传了吗?

顾名思义,材料UI是预先配置与谷歌的材料设计工作. 作为一个结果, 您将能够访问用户看起来和感觉很熟悉的组件库. 这可以帮助您快速地开始使用库,同时尽可能少地花费时间对组件进行样式化并试验CSS. 

材料设计是一个完整的设计系统,它解释了各种可访问组件的用途,并提供了如何在整个项目中使用它们的例子. 你不仅得到了一个已经符合材料设计的库, 但是你也可以使用材质图标. 这需要有一组一致的图标来选择,这些图标与所使用的设计系统相兼容.

您是否正在寻找一个强大的API工具,可以帮助您以最无损的方式上传和传输内容? 下载 Filestack 今天可以帮助您与您的材质UI文件上传.

留下一个回复